Air Force Col. David C. Schilling makes the first nonstop transatlantic flight in a jet aircraft, flying a Republic F-84E from Manston, England, to Limestone (later Loring) Air Force Base, Maine, in 10 hours, one minute. The trip requires three in-flight refuelings.
